Output d309277a03aebfe7877626916633f492f5dec6767dff8e843c4c9ae26b111e6b:0

value
1355386895
script pubkey
OP_0 OP_PUSHBYTES_20 5180853e03f2bab542c5f75ab77166dfc99264c0
address
bc1q2xqg20sr72at2sk97adtwutxmlyeyexq7q7dek
transaction
d309277a03aebfe7877626916633f492f5dec6767dff8e843c4c9ae26b111e6b
spent
true